Leaking Dishwasher


This is probably one of the most daily dishwasher trouble, and also fortunately is that it is easy to recognize. Leaks occur as a result of a number of reasons, as well as the leaks can ruin your kitchen area. Usual root causes of dishwasher leakages consist of;
  • Improper pipeline connection: If the pipelines at the rear of your machine are not firmly taken care of or if they are broken, it can cause leakages.

  • Incorrect dish piling: Always make certain that you do not overstack the tray and that you prepare the meals properly

  • Way too much detergent: Placing more than enough detergent can likewise create a leak. Make certain that you put simply enough for your recipes as well as not extra.

  • Rust: It can also be a result of some corrosion or rust of your equipment. In this case, it is far better to replace the dish washer.

  • Door Seals: Check if the door seals are still undamaged and safely attached. If the seals are not in position, maybe a significant cause of leakages.

  • Does unclean correctly

  • If your recipes and flatwares appear of the dishwasher as well as still look dirty or unclean, your spray arms might be a problem. Oftentimes, the spray arms can obtain obstructed, and it will call for a quick clean or a substitute to work efficiently once more.

    Inability to Drain


    Often you might discover a big quantity of water left in your bathtub after a wash. That is probably a drain trouble. You can either check the drain pipe for problems or blockages. When unsure, contact a professional to have it inspected and also fixed.
  • Bad-Smelling Dish washer

  • This is another usual dishwasher problem, as well as it is generally brought on by food debris or grease remaining in the equipment. In this case, look for these bits, take them out as well as do the meals with no dishes inside the machine. Wash the filter completely. That will assist do away with the negative scent. Ensure that you remove every food particle from your dishes before transferring it to the machine in the future.

    Dishwasher Won’t Drain? 8 Steps to Fix It


    Run the Disposal


    A full garbage disposal or an air gap in a connecting hose can prevent water from properly draining out of the dishwasher. Simply running the disposal for about 30 seconds may fix the issue.


    Check for Blockages


    Check the bottom of the dishwasher to make sure that an item or pieces of food haven't fallen from the rack to block the water flow.


    Load the Dishwasher Correctly


    Make sure you’re loading the dishwasher correctly. Read the manufacturers’ instructions or owner’s manual for tips and directions on how to load dishes for best results.


    Clean or Change the Filter


    You may have a clogged dishwasher filter that’s preventing water from draining. Many homeowners don’t realize that dishwasher filters need to be cleaned regularly. Check your owner’s manual to see where the filter is located on your dishwasher, and for instructions on how and when to clean it. For many dishwashers, the filter can be found on the inside bottom of the appliance.


    Inspect the Drain Hose


    Check the drain hose connecting to the sink and garbage disposal. Straighten any kinks that you may see, which could be causing the problem. Blow through the hose or poke a wire hanger through to check for clogs. Make sure the hose seal is tight, too.


    Try Vinegar and Baking Soda


    Mix together about one cup each of baking soda and vinegar and pour the mixture into the standing water at the bottom of the dishwasher. Leave for about 20 minutes. If the water is draining or starting to drain at that time, rinse with hot water and then run the dishwasher’s rinse cycle. That may be enough to help loosen any clogs or debris that are preventing the dishwasher from draining properly.


    Listen to Your Machine While It's Running


    Listen to your dishwasher while it’s running a cycle. If it doesn’t make the usual operating sounds, particularly if it’s making a humming or clicking noise, the drain pump and motor may need replacing. If this occurs, it may be time to call a professional for help.
